southeast in French
southeast in French is sud-est — southeast means the direction exactly between south and east.
southeast in French
sud-est
The intercardinal compass point halfway between east and south; specifically at a bearing of 135°.
What does "southeast" mean?
-
noun The direction exactly between south and east.
"The storm is moving to the southeast."
-
adjective Situated toward or coming from the southeast.
"A southeast wind picked up in the afternoon."
